How to Specify the Recurring Journal Entry Number Rather than Using Number Sequencing

We make several Journal Entries each month. We have them all saved as recurring transactions. But we have very specific numbering/naming conventions we would like to use for each. Is there a way to add the desired JE number to the recurring transaction instead of QB assigning the recurring JEs a number in sequence from the last created JE?

Example: we want to the JE numbers to be

ME01 COGS PR MM-YY

ME02 CAPEX MM-YY

ME15 PRPD T&T MM-YY

 

This month when the recurring JEs were generated, the last JE that was made in QB was numbered "REV16 PREP COMM 40", so the recurring JEs were created with the following names, which are not at all what they  should be.

REV16 PREP COMM 41

REV16 PREP COMM 42

REV16 PREP COMM 43

I understand how challenging it is to manually edit the number sequencing of recurring Journal Entries one at a time in QuickBooks Online (QBO). However, the option to automatically specify the sequential numbering is currently unavailable in QBO. 

 

I can see how this will benefit other business owners, as well. Don't worry. I'll help you relay this valuable insight to our software developers. This way, they can review all your feedback and will consider incorporating it in our future product updates. 

 

To do that:

 

  1. Go to the Gear icon.
  2. Select Feedback under Profile.
  3. Enter a description of your feature request, and select Next.
